Igor Putko 33da57cc4a staging: nvec: nvec_power: use GFP_KERNEL in probe()
nvec_power_probe() calls devm_kzalloc() with GFP_NOWAIT, which
disables direct reclaim and is meant for atomic context. probe()
runs in normal process context and may sleep, so this needlessly
risks a spurious -ENOMEM under memory pressure instead of just
waiting for reclaim like every other probe() allocation does.

nvec.c's own tegra_nvec_probe() already uses GFP_KERNEL for the
identical pattern, confirming this is an oversight, not intentional.

NVEC: An NVidia compliant Embedded Controller Protocol Implementation

This is an implementation of the NVEC protocol used to communicate with an
embedded controller (EC) via I2C bus. The EC is an I2C master while the host
processor is the I2C slave. Requests from the host processor to the EC are
started by triggering a gpio line.

There is no written documentation of the protocol available to the public,
but the source code[1] of the published nvec reference drivers can be a guide.
This driver is currently only used by the AC100 project[2], but it is likely,
that other Tegra boards (not yet mainlined, if ever) also use it.
